IT is hard enough for a player to come into a massive club like Celtic and impress, but when they also have to contend with a global pandemic and the not inconsiderable task of ousting the club captain from his position, then it is little wonder that Ismaila Soro took a little time to find his feet...
Continue ReadingGet the FREE Celticnewsnow app